Futureproof Ultra

Developers who have attained the Futureproof Ultra award have built their houses to the house of tomorrow spec.

The House of Tomorrow project was put in place to stimulate the widespread uptake of sustainable energy design, specification and superior construction practices.

Kingspan Century can help you meet these requirements.

A new EU directive in the Energy Performance of Buildings (EPBD) is about to become law in Ireland. Now for the first time everyone will need to know, the exact energy performance of your house. Buying a home is like buying a fridge or washing machine, efficiency will be everything. Buyers will compare properties noting their energy ratings.
